samba: SMB clients can truncate files with read-only permissions
A vulnerability was discovered in Samba, where the flaw allows SMB clients to truncate files, even with read-only permissions when the Samba VFS module "aclxattr" is configured with "aclxattr:ignore system acls = yes". CVE-2023-36641
CVE-2023-36641 is a DoS vulnerability caused by a numeric truncation error in Fortinet FortiProxy/FortiOS. Affected products include FortiProxy 1.0–2.0 and FortiOS 6.x–7.x, with exploits triggered by specially crafted HTTP requests. Red Hat, CNVD, and other sources corroborate the DoS impact and ...
python: file path truncation at \0 characters
Python 3.11 os.path.normpath function is vulnerable to path truncation if a null byte is inserted in the middle of passed path. This may result in bypass of allow lists if implemented before the verification of the path...

httpd: mod_proxy_uwsgi HTTP response splitting
An HTTP Response Smuggling vulnerability was found in the Apache HTTP Server via modproxyuwsgi. This security issue occurs when special characters in the origin response header can truncate or split the response forwarded to the client...
